无法ping域名通常意味着网络连接存在问题,可能是DNS解析问题、网络配置错误、防火墙设置或目标服务器不可达等原因。
确保本地计算机的DNS设置正确。可以通过以下命令查看和修改DNS设置:
# 查看当前DNS设置
cat /etc/resolv.conf
# 修改DNS设置(示例)
echo "nameserver 8.8.8.8" > /etc/resolv.conf
确保本地网络配置正确,包括IP地址、子网掩码和网关:
# 查看当前网络配置
ifconfig
# 修改网络配置(示例)
sudo ifconfig eth0 192.168.1.100 netmask 255.255.255.0 up
确保防火墙允许ICMP请求。可以通过以下命令检查和修改防火墙设置:
# 检查防火墙状态
sudo iptables -L
# 允许ICMP请求(示例)
sudo iptables -A INPUT -p icmp --icmp-type echo-request -j ACCEPT
确保目标服务器正常运行,并且可以从其他网络访问。可以通过以下命令检查服务器状态:
# 检查服务器是否可达
ping example.com
通过以上步骤,您应该能够诊断并解决无法ping域名的问题。如果问题仍然存在,建议进一步检查网络日志或联系网络管理员。
没有搜到相关的沙龙